比特币的秘密密匙是用来生成公开密匙和地址、执行交易、保证交易正当性的签名的密匙。随机的数字和字母的字符串,通常是256位(32个字符的16进制)。
比特币的秘密密匙需要以下步骤。
生成随机密钥:你需要生成随机的256位数字。这个数字是你的秘密密匙。这通常是在密码库中进行的,比如Pyho的secres库。
数字签名:需要使用椭圆曲线算法(如SECP256K1)和公钥生成算法(如ECDH)进行RSA签名。通常通过比特币的节点和钱包软件来处理,用户不需要用手计算。
3.从私钥到公钥使用生成的私钥,用椭圆曲线算法(ECDSA等)计算公钥。这个过程需要私钥和椭圆曲线的参数。
4.公开钥匙?